8. Zimbabwe and Zambia

Border: Victoria Falls Area: 700 km²

Estimated Gross Domestic Product: $70 billion (Zambia) / $37 billion (Zimbabwe)

Victoria Falls, dubbed "Mosi-oa-Tunya" or "The Smoke That Thunders," forms a breathtaking natural border between Zambia and Zimbabwe. Among the world's largest and most iconic waterfalls, it is born from the Zambezi River crashing into a deep gorge. The roaring water sends mist soaring, visible from miles away, amplifying its grandeur.

This natural wonder not only flaunts nature's artistry but also fortifies cultural and economic links between the nations, drawing global tourists and uplifting local livelihoods.

Victoria Falls stands as a shared treasure, offering distinct perspectives from both Zambia and Zimbabwe. Zambia's Knife-edge Bridge delivers intimate views, while Zimbabwe unveils expansive sights of the falls' majesty.

As a beacon of unity and natural splendor, Victoria Falls transcends political divides, captivating visitors worldwide. Its dramatic landscapes and thunderous waters create lasting memories, fostering closeness between the two countries.
